Key Features
- 8-bit PIC16 CPU core operating from 2 V to 5.5 V supply range, ideal for low-power battery applications
- Integrated 5-channel 10-bit ADC with sample-and-hold, supporting analog sensor interfacing without external components
- 28-pin SOIC package (MS-013) with 22 general-purpose I/O pins, USART, SPI, and I2C communication interfaces
Applications
The PIC16LF873A-I/SO is well suited for low-voltage embedded control applications such as battery-powered sensors, portable medical devices, and industrial automation nodes requiring minimal power consumption. Its integrated ADC and communication peripherals make it effective in data acquisition systems, HVAC controllers, and smart home appliances. The 28-pin SOIC package fits compact PCB designs where space and cost are constrained.

Frequently Asked Questions
What is the minimum operating voltage for PIC16LF873A-I/SO and how does it benefit portable designs?
The PIC16LF873A-I/SO operates from as low as 2 V supply, allowing it to run directly from a single Li-ion cell or two AA batteries. This 2 V minimum threshold extends battery life significantly compared to 5 V-only microcontrollers, making it ideal for handheld and wireless sensor nodes where power budget is critical.
How many ADC channels does the PIC16LF873A-I/SO provide and what is the resolution?
The PIC16LF873A-I/SO includes a 5-channel, 10-bit ADC with integrated sample-and-hold circuitry. The 10-bit resolution delivers 1024 discrete levels, sufficient for temperature, pressure, and light sensing without requiring an external ADC chip, reducing BOM cost and PCB area.
When should an engineer choose PIC16LF873A-I/SO over PIC16F873A for a new design?
Choose PIC16LF873A-I/SO when the system supply voltage is below 4.5 V or when minimizing active and sleep-mode current is a priority. The LF variant is rated for 2 V to 5.5 V operation and draws less current in run mode at 4 MHz than the standard PIC16F873A, which requires 4 V minimum. Both share identical 4 KB flash and 128 bytes RAM, so firmware is binary-compatible.
What serial communication interfaces are available on the PIC16LF873A-I/SO?
The PIC16LF873A-I/SO integrates a USART for asynchronous RS-232 or synchronous SPI communication, plus a MSSP module supporting both SPI and I2C protocols up to 400 kHz in I2C fast mode. These 3 communication interfaces allow connection to sensors, EEPROMs, displays, and host processors without external interface ICs.
